Grand jury indicts former DeKalb County commissioner on bribery, extortion chargesBy Cal Callaway, Aungelique Proctor, FOX 5 NewsPosted May 21 2019 09:05AM EDTUpdated May 21 2019 11:04PM EDTSTONE MOUNTAIN, Ga. (FOX 5 Atlanta) - A federal grand jury in the Northern District of Georgia has indicted former DeKalb County Commissioner Sharon Barnes Sutton on two counts of extortion and one count of bribery, the U.S. Department of Justice in Washington, D.C. announced on Tuesday.Agents with the Federal Bureau of Investigation arrested Barnes Sutton, 59, at her DeKalb County home early Tuesday morning without incident. ...The indictment alleges that in May 2014, Barnes Sutton accepted money from a contractor in exchange for the awarding of a contract for the Snapfinger Creek Advanced Wastewater Treatment Facility. ...
Outgoing DeKalb commissioner spent nearly $10,000 on 21-page reportNews Jan 10, 2017By Mark Niesse, The Atlanta Journal-Constitution Before DeKalb Commissioner Sharon Barnes Sutton left office, she spent $9,100 in taxpayer money to prepare a 21-page report about her eight years in county government, according to Channel 2 Action News.The transition report lists her successes and challenges before she lost re-election last year to Steve Bradshaw, who now represents the Stone Mountain-area district. ...
